Rep. Mike Molgano Endorses Chris Meek for Congress

[Editor's Note: This announcement was originally published on Jan. 25.]

State Representative Mike Molgano (R-144) has joined the growing list of people who have endorsed Chris Meek for Congress.

“As someone born and raised in Stamford, I can say that I have seen firsthand the work Chris Meek has done in the community to help people stay in their homes, find jobs that pay well, and get their lives back on track,” Molgano said. “Chris’ selfless concern even goes beyond the home front. Chris worked diligently to create Soldier Socks, a non-profit volunteer organization whose mission is to provide our troops in Iraq and Afghanistan with basic essentials found in short supply abroad. Chris knows hard work and has true compassion for others. He is the type of lead-by-example and caring leader that we need representing us in Congress.”

Meek, a father of three, lives in Stamford with his wife Christine and their children.

“To have someone who has dedicated his life to public service like Mike Molgano support our campaign is humbling and brings us closer to defeating our opponent in November,” Meek said.

Molgano’s endorsement joins a growing list of prominent people supporting Chris Meek in his bid to become the 4th District’s congressman. Already supporting Meek are former Lieutenant Governor Mike Fedele, Former Ambassador Charlie Glazer, State Representative Terrie Wood (R-141), State Representative Livvy Floren (R-149) and Assistant Republican Leader in the Connecticut House of Representatives DebraLee Hoovey (R-112).
